What companies run services between Le Burgundy Paris, France and Paris, France?
RATP Metro operates a subway from Madeleine to Châtelet every 5 minutes. Tickets cost €3 and the journey takes 3 min. Alternatively, Régie Autonome des Transports Parisiens (RATP) operates a bus from Anjou - Chauveau Lagarde to Luxembourg every 20 minutes. Tickets cost €3 and the journey takes 20 min.
